🌴 Why Visit Costa Rica in November?

November is when Costa Rica begins to transition out of the green season, especially on the Pacific side. The heavy rains of September and October ease up, and the days start to clear, making it a perfect time for nature lovers and savvy travelers.

Top reasons to visit in November:

  • 🌤️ More sunshine, fewer tourists

  • 🐢 Final weeks of sea turtle nesting on Pacific beaches

  • 💸 Pre-high season pricing on tours and hotels

  • 🌿 Lush rainforests and full waterfalls

  • 🧘 Tranquil vibes before the December crowds

  • 📸 Dramatic skies, colorful sunsets, and vivid scenery


🌦️ What’s the Weather Like in November?

November weather is all about change—and depending on where you go in Costa Rica, you’ll notice varying conditions:

☀️ Pacific Coast (Guanacaste, Nicoya, Tamarindo):
This region starts to dry out, with sunny mornings and occasional afternoon showers early in the month. By mid-to-late November, the weather is reliably dry, and temps average 82–90°F (28–32°C). It's a fantastic time for beach lovers and surfers before the high season kicks in.

🌿 Central Pacific (Manuel Antonio, Dominical, Uvita):
Rain still lingers a bit longer here but becomes more sporadic as the month progresses. Expect warm days between 78–86°F (25–30°C) with lush tropical scenery—perfect for exploring national parks and waterfalls.

🌞 Caribbean Coast (Puerto Viejo, Tortuguero):
November brings more rainfall to the Caribbean side, but it’s still possible to enjoy clear mornings and afternoon showers. Temperatures stay tropical at 77–85°F (25–29°C). Excellent for jungle wildlife viewing and off-the-beaten-path beach adventures.

🌋 Central Valley (San José, Cartago, Heredia):
Temperate year-round, this area sees less rain and cool breezes in November. Temperatures hover between 65–75°F (18–24°C), ideal for cultural excursions and coffee tours.

🌫 Highlands (Arenal, Monteverde, La Fortuna):
This region remains misty and romantic, with daytime temps around 60–75°F (16–24°C). Rain begins to taper off, and the forests are alive with wildlife and greenery.

🎉 Cultural Highlights in November

  • Dia de los Santos (Nov. 1):
    All Saints' Day is a quiet but meaningful holiday across Costa Rica, with families visiting cemeteries and honoring loved ones.

  • Black Friday & Early Christmas Markets:
    Toward the end of the month, local shops and markets begin offering holiday sales and festive events—great for picking up artisan souvenirs.
